Building a VM containing devstack is faster if you can save
the cache files for pip in a location that is not deleted
when the VM is rebuilt. This change allows the user to
set the PIP_DOWNLOAD_CACHE in their localrc file to point
to any directory writable by root, including a directory
mounted from the host containing the VM.

Editing ENABLED_SERVICES directly can get tricky when
the user wants to disable something. This patch includes
two new functions for adding or removing services
safely, and a third (for completeness) to clear the
settings entirely before adding a minimal set of
services.
It also moves the logic for dealing with "negated"
services into a function so it can be tested and
applied by the new functions for manipulating
ENABLED_SERVICES.

This lets the user assert that stack.sh should never need to clone
any git repositories. If set to True, and devstack does need to
clone a git repo, stack.sh will exit with an error.
This is useful in testing environments to make sure that the correct
code is being tested instead of silently falling back on cloning
from the public repos.
